小编Dar*_*lar的帖子

EF6中的多租户,具有多个具有相同表的模式

在我们的系统中,需要提供多租户解决方案,其中每个租户具有相同的数据结构.

在调查期间,我发现了一篇与EF4.1讨论多租户的文章.

http://romiller.com/2011/05/23/ef-4-1-multi-tenant-with-code-first/

这看起来是一个明智的解决方案,但如果可能的话,我们宁愿避免多个数据库上下文.

此外,我们对当前的单租户解决方案进行了大量迁移.使用EF6,迁移可以定位到特定上下文,如果不支持,则会定位默认值.

我在这里有几个问题:

  1. 当使用EF6而不是为EF4指定的EF6时,是否有更好的多租户方法?
  2. 有没有更好的方法来处理迁移?

任何帮助深表感谢!

.net c# sql-server entity-framework entity-framework-6

9
推荐指数
1
解决办法
883
查看次数